Financial Systems Analyst implements, maintains, and updates the systems that store and process financial data. Modifies system menus, edits spreadsheets and reports, and troubleshoots system problems. Being a Financial Systems Analyst imports files to and exports files from financial databases. Generates reports and conducts analyses on financial systems data. Additionally, Financial Systems Analyst collaborates with internal teams to determine primary needs and goals and creates solutions to meet those objectives. Trains staff on the use of financial systems and acts as a liaison to the information technology department.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The Financial Systems Analyst work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. To be a Financial Systems Analyst typically requires 4-7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Summary of role:
Lantheus Digital Finance Team is looking for an enthusiastic self-starter who shall be responsible for the maintenance and support of our financial planning systems viz., SAP S4 HANA and S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C) and supporting the FP&A team with monthly & quarterly actual and forecast/ budget reporting. The ideal candidate should be excited about being the System Admin of our financial systems and have advanced Excel skills to make routine tasks more efficient. This individual should be eager to work in a fast-paced growth company and gain exposure to reporting and forecasting for the corporate enterprise.
